About

This study is to evaluate the fitting performance of stenfilcon A contact lens (test) compared to narafilcon A contact lens (control).

Full description

This study is to evaluate the fitting performance of stenfilcon A contact lens (test) compared to narafilcon A contact lens (control) over 3 hour of wear time in a Japanese population.

Inclusion criteria

A person is eligible for inclusion in the study if he/she:

  • Is Japanese
  • Has had a self-reported oculo-visual examination in the last two years.
  • Is at least 18 years of age and has full legal capacity to volunteer.
  • Has read and understood the informed consent letter.
  • Is willing and able to follow instructions and maintain the appointment schedule.
  • Is correctable to a visual acuity of 20/40 or better (in each eye) with their habitual vision correction or 20/20 best-corrected.
  • Currently wears soft contact lenses.
  • Has clear corneas and no active ocular disease.

Exclusion criteria

A person will be excluded from the study if he/she:

  • Has never worn contact lenses before.
  • Has any systemic disease affecting ocular health.
  • Is using any systemic or topical medications that will affect ocular health.
  • Has any ocular pathology or severe insufficiency of lacrimal secretion (moderate to severe dry eyes) that would affect the wearing of contact lenses.
  • Has persistent, clinically significant corneal or conjunctival staining using sodium fluorescein dye.
  • Has any clinically significant lid or conjunctival abnormalities, active neovascularization or any central corneal scars.
  • Is aphakic.
  • Has undergone corneal refractive surgery.
  • Is participating in any other type of eye related clinical or research study.
